TeacherActive is looking for a passionate Key Stage 2 Teacher in Bristol. This permanent role offers a salary of £32,916 - £45,352 per year. You will work in a diverse primary school that values individuality and aspires for high achievements.

The successful candidate should bring creativity and strong behaviour management skills in creating an inspiring environment for students, helping them develop confidence and a love for learning.

How to prepare for a job interview at TeacherActive

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you’re well-versed in the KS2 curriculum and the specific needs of the students you'll be teaching. Brush up on creative teaching methods and behaviour management strategies that can help foster a love of learning.

Show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share personal anecdotes or experiences that highlight your passion for inspiring confidence in students and creating an engaging classroom environment.

Prepare Thoughtful Questions

Think of insightful questions to ask about the school’s approach to diversity and individuality.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in their values and how you can contribute to their mission of high achievement.

Demonstrate Your Creativity

Be ready to discuss innovative lesson plans or activities you’ve implemented in the past. Highlight how these ideas not only engaged students but also helped them build confidence and a love for learning.
